Analysis

In 1998, domestic currency per us dollar (end-of-period (eop)) in Portugal stood at 171.83.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 6.3% on the previous year and up 17.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, domestic currency per us dollar (end-of-period (eop)) in Portugal peaked at 183.33 in 1997 and was at its lowest, 24.6, in 1974.

Portugal ranks 59th of 220 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Domestic currency per US dollar (End-of-period (EoP)) in Portugal, year by year

Annual values for Domestic currency per US dollar (End-of-period (EoP)) in Portugal, 1950 to 1998.
Year Value Change
1950 28.9
1951 28.9 +0.0%
1952 28.9 +0.0%
1953 28.9 +0.0%
1954 28.9 +0.0%
1955 28.9 +0.0%
1956 28.9 +0.0%
1957 28.75 -0.5%
1958 28.75 +0.0%
1959 28.88 +0.5%
1960 28.83 -0.2%
1961 28.8 -0.1%
1962 28.85 +0.2%
1963 28.89 +0.1%
1964 28.95 +0.2%
1965 28.83 -0.4%
1966 28.98 +0.5%
1967 28.86 -0.4%
1968 28.77 -0.3%
1969 28.65 -0.4%
1970 28.75 +0.3%
1971 27.56 -4.1%
1972 27 -2.0%
1973 25.84 -4.3%
1974 24.6 -4.8%
1975 27.47 +11.7%
1976 31.55 +14.8%
1977 39.85 +26.3%
1978 46.01 +15.4%
1979 49.78 +8.2%
1980 53.04 +6.5%
1981 65.25 +23.0%
1982 89.06 +36.5%
1983 131.45 +47.6%
1984 169.28 +28.8%
1985 157.49 -7.0%
1986 146.12 -7.2%
1987 129.87 -11.1%
1988 146.37 +12.7%
1989 149.84 +2.4%
1990 133.6 -10.8%
1991 134.18 +0.4%
1992 146.76 +9.4%
1993 176.81 +20.5%
1994 159.09 -10.0%
1995 149.41 -6.1%
1996 156.38 +4.7%
1997 183.33 +17.2%
1998 171.83 -6.3%
